Model Town incident: AC allows JIT to grill Nawaz in Kot Lakhpat Jail
ISLAMABAD: Former prime minister Nawaz Sharif will face another Joint Investigation Team (JIT) in Kot Lakhpat Jail, as accountability court, Islamabad on Thursday granted JIT on Model Town incident to interrogate him.
Deputy Superintendent of Punjab Police Muhammad Iqbal on Thursday moved an application before accountability court judge Arshad Malik seeking his permission to interrogate under prison former PM Nawaz Sharif in Kot lakhpat Jail, regarding the Model Town incident.
Former PM Nawaz Sharif is currently serving his 7-year sentence in Al-Azizia reference in Kot Lakhpat jail. During hearing, DSP Muhammad Iqbal requested the court to allow JIT to interrogate former PM Nawaz Sharif, as he has also been nominated as accused in Model Town incident in 2014. To this, National Accountability Bureau Prosecutor Mirza Usman opposed the JIT's application and said instead of approaching accountability court, investigation officer should approach the Islamabad High Court (IHC) to seek such permission.
Accountability Court Judge Arshad Malik allowed DSP Muhammad Iqbal to interrogate former PM Nawaz Sharif in Kot Lakhpat Jail.
